House Prices (2025)

Most affordable in Wales

The average house price in Shotton is £167,332, which is 31% less than Buckley at £219,761. The most affordable entry point in Buckley is a flat at £124,812, while in Shotton it is a flat at £88,000.

Average Price by Property Type (2025)

Biggest gap: terraced homes are 46% pricier in Buckley (£176,095 vs £120,688).

Price Trend (11 Years)

Over the last 9 years, Shotton prices grew faster — 42% vs 30%.

Broadband & Connectivity

Shotton offers faster average downloads at 457.0 Mbps, compared to 364.1 Mbps in Buckley. Superfast coverage (30 Mbps+) reaches 93.1% of premises in Buckley and 97.2% in Shotton. Gigabit availability stands at 67.8% in Buckley and 89.4% in Shotton.

Shotton is the faster of the two by 26% on average download speed (457 vs 364 Mbps).

Energy Efficiency & Running Costs

Homes in Shotton are more energy-efficient on average, with an EPC score of 71.1 (band C) versus 69.3 (band D) in Buckley. Estimated annual energy costs average £1,322 in Buckley and £1,221 in Shotton. 57.6% of homes in Buckley have an EPC rating of C or above, compared to 65.1% in Shotton.

Shotton has more energy-efficient housing — 65.1% reach band C or above, vs 57.6% in the other.

Demographics & Economy

Median household income is £30,594 in Shotton and £27,910 in Buckley. The median age is 45.9 in Buckley and 44.9 in Shotton. Employment rates stand at 54.8% in Buckley and 57.9% in Shotton. Owner-occupancy is 68.8% in Buckley versus 71.8% in Shotton.
